Classic massage

It is a process that has both therapeutic and relaxing effect on the entire body. Medium strength technique of this massage makes up the basis for many other types of massages: head, shoulder, arm, back, buttocks, hip, leg, foot massage, etc. Even after few sessions, this massage recovers the main functions of the body, improves tissue elasticity and joint mobility, improves general condition, removes muscle fatigue, and tones up.

Short description. Massaging starts from the back and progresses down through thighs towards calves and finishes with massaging foot and arms. Classic massage is performed with the help of four main techniques. These are the following: gliding, frictions, kneading, and vibration. During the session, various natural oils are used, and specially selected music is played. All these enhance the effect of the massage. It is advisable for the client to remove outerwear during the massage.

Back massage

Back problems is a rather common issue. Many people experience what they call a locked-up back pain. Back massage offers efficient solution to spine problems and relieves pain. Massage movements stimulate blood flow, reduce stiffness, enhance flexibility, and stimulate muscle strength. The process of treatments must be complex, therefore a back massage must be followed by shoulder and neck massages.
A unique feature of a human being is seven neck vertebrae, which support the head and allows for incredible movements. A well-functioning neck allows for smooth functioning of lumbosacral plexus, blood vessels, digestion and respiratory tract. Local neck strains, headache, limb stiffness and various functional disorders are treated by means of manual massage therapy.

Sports massage

Muscles of an individual who engages in sports and active physical activity do not receive enough rest, which causes occurrence of nodules in muscle tissues – fibrositis. Fibrositis in turn can cause emotional strain when in the shoulder area. These disorders are treated by means of sports massage therapy. Also, sports massage is an excellent way to treat injured muscles. This treatment method involves active stimulation of muscle tissue, and reduction of muscle tension as the nerve and blood flow channels are released, which results in limitation of the incurred damage, reduced pain, and improved circulation.The type and duration of the sports massage depends on the sport the patient is engaged in, the sex, age and weight of the patient. The massage starts at the neck and progresses towards the back, legs, chest, arms, and stomach. Vigorous massage movements on the limb opposite to the injured one, or on the limbs below the injured limbs, does not affect the therapeutic process and reduces the pain. Passive, active and resistance-inducing movements help to recover flexibility, strength, and coordination.

Vacuum massage

When the human body can not process the required amount of lymph, passive lymphatic flow results in swelling-cellulite of legs, arms, face and the entire body. A solution to this problem is a complex of massages made with a new generation French vacuum apparatus STARVAC. It is the most efficient and irreplaceable means for figure correction and treatment of cellulite. How does STARVAC apparatus work? The session starts with stimulation of problematic body parts by placing four double suction cups. The cups are placed on the body in various combinations depending on the structure of each individual client and his/her needs. Vacuum that is created in the cup sucks in a part of the skin thus improving the functioning of lymphatic and blood circulation systems. Special cup shape allows performing the massage in interrupted manner. The massage not only stimulates fat burning processes but also removes toxins from tissues.
During the next stage, the apparatus is switched to the uninterrupted mode, and the therapy is continued using a roller and special deep movements which help to brake down fat material and thus enhance correction of problematic areas. Two external rollers improves the massage and helps to remove uneven subcutaneous layer - cellulite.
Vacuum massage procedure with STARVAC apparatus takes 45 min. and involves intensive vacuum anti-cellulite massage for belly, waist, front side of the thighs, buttocks, back side of the thighs, legs, back and arms.

Contraindications:

  • enlarged veins, varicose veins;
  • heart and vascular system disorders;
  • oncological diseases;
  • pregnancy;
  • hypertonia;
  • viral diseases.

Children's posture correction massage

Spine consists of 33 vertebrae that support head, chest, and large lumbar vertebrae support the abdominal cavity. Typically, the lumbar spine is subject to huge loads since the very early age, which results in lordosis - inward curvature of the lumbar spine.

During childhood, domination of the right or left hand or leg can cause spine deviation called scoliosis. Spine deviation can also occur due to genetic causes.
We all know that children spend increasingly more time at the computer with incorrect body position harming the spine. In all cases, massage and movement help to reduce spine deviation and can mitigate discomfort caused by progressive diseases, therefore we recommend posture correction massage for children and teenagers.

This massage is intended for children over 3 years of age.

Lymphatic drainage massage

The flow of lymph in the human body depend on the muscle tone. When the human body can not process the required amount of lymph, passive lymphatic flow results in swelling of legs, arms, face and the entire body. A solution to this problem could be a lymphatic drainage massage performed solely by hands.

Short description.This massage helps to reduce lymphatic congestion which affects the flow of lymph. As the skin itself is very sensitive and lymphatic fluid can build up in the skin, the massage involves slow and gentle rhythmical movements. Also, the massage stimulates circulation which ensures the body is supplied with nutrients.
